How much do remote web manager j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ote web manager in Oxnard, CA is $85,620.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$58,200.00 and $100,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ote web manager?

A Remote Web Manager is a professional responsible for overseeing the operation, maintenance, and optimization of websites while working from a remote location. They manage web content, ensure site functionality, coordinate with development and design teams, and monitor web analytics to improve performance. Remote Web Managers also handle troubleshooting, updates, and security measures to keep websites running smoothly. Excellent communication and technical skills are vital for collaborating with distributed teams and meeting business goals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ote web manager?

To thrive as a Remote Web Manager, you need expertise in web development, content management systems (CMS), and digital strategy, often supported by a degree in web design, computer science, or related fields. Familiarity with tools such as WordPress, Google Analytics, HTML/CSS, and project management platforms like Trello or Asana is typically required. Excellent communication, organizational skills, and self-motivation are vital for remote collaboration and overseeing web projects across distributed teams. These skills ensure the effective operation, optimization, and continual improvement of web platforms from any location.

What are some common challenges faced by remote web managers and how can they be addressed?

Remote Web Managers often face challenges related to coordinating across time zones, maintaining clear communication with various stakeholders, and ensuring website performance without direct, in-person oversight. To address these, it's helpful to establish regular check-ins, use collaborative project management tools, and set clear expectations for response times and deliverables. Additionally, building strong documentation practices and leveraging analytics can help keep projects on track and ensure seamless collaboration within a distributed team.
